====Verb====
{{en-verb|clos|ing}}

# To obstruct (an opening).
# To move so that it closes its opening.
#: '''''Close''' the door behind you when you leave.''
#: ''Jim was listening to headphones with his eyes '''closed'''.''
# To put an [[end]] to.
#: '''''close''' the session''
# To make (e.g. a gap) smaller.
#: ''The runner in second place is '''closing''' the gap on the leader.''
# {{surveying}} To have a [[vector]] sum of 0; that is, to form a closed [[polygon]].
# {{marketing}} To make a [[sale]].
# {{baseball|pitching}} To make the final outs, usually three, of a game.
#: ''He has '''closed''' the last two games for his team.''

====Adjective====
{{en-adj|clos|er}}

# At a little distance; [[near]].
#: ''Is your house '''close'''?''
# Intimate; well-loved.
#: ''He is a '''close''' friend.''
#: {{legal}} Of a corporation or other business entity, [[closely held]].
# {{context|Ireland|weather}} hot, [[humid]].

====Noun====
{{en-noun}}

# {{British}} A [[street]] that ends in a [[dead end]].
# {{Scotland}} A very narrow [[alley]] between two buildings, often [[overhang|overhung]] by one of the buildings above the ground floor.
# A [[cathedral close]].
